Output d2c21de15539bd576b8b0602f21caa48bb002bcf56128d66bf643492aea1ecba:0

value
21046399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ab62376dea4948ab7b7239361345fef24b2372e9 OP_EQUALVERIFY OP_CHECKSIG
address
1GdCD1NuXYWJ2TwUzUmSvLjTpBQWVHBzj4
transaction
d2c21de15539bd576b8b0602f21caa48bb002bcf56128d66bf643492aea1ecba
confirmations
425834
spent
true